  • The South African Reserve Bank is the central bank of South Africa. It was established in 1921 after Parliament passed an act, the "Currency and Bank Act of 10 August 1920", as a direct result of the abnormal monetary and financial conditions which World War I had brought

    (918) Supervisor - Processing Operations - Johannesburg CC - CMD

    Detailed description

    The successful candidate will be responsible for the following key performance areas: 

    • Supervise the team’s administrative processes and ensure the accuracy and completeness of record-keeping. 
    • Supervise quality, facilitate the delivery of the section-specific outputs and optimise and manage section resources (including banknote processing machines and people).
    • Ensure adherence to controls, established practices and the given processes, rules and regulations by self and note processors, ensuring compliance with standards, policies and other guidelines. 
    • Supervise and review the work by team members to ensure the accuracy and completeness of the information integrated through the National Cash Management Solution. 
    • Diagnose problems and choose or modify routines to deal with them, displaying the ability to provide solutions for problems within a defined context. 
    • Engage with internal stakeholders, displaying the ability to deliver a coherent and convincing message.
    • Stay abreast of developments in the cash environment and ensure the application thereof by self and team members.
    • Propose and implement the refinement and continual improvement of systems, tools, methods and processes in own area.
    • Plan work for self and banknote processors in the team, using discretion in defining and prioritising work for the team.
    • Evaluate own performance against given criteria and identify and address task-specific learning needs.
    • Take responsibility for managing the performance and development of the team.

    Qualifications

    To be considered for this position, candidates must be in possession of:

    • a National Diploma in Business Management (NQF 6) or an equivalent qualification; and
    • three to five years’ experience in a cash-handling environment, with at least one year of supervisory experience.
